When to go to Ch’ŏltuk

  • Consider your ideal weather conditions when choosing your trip dates. With maximum highs of 29ºC (84ºF), August brings the warmest conditions.

  • January is the coolest month, with lows of -3ºC (27ºF).

  • Browse around for Ch’ŏltuk hotels in January for your best shot at clearer skies. Averaging two days of rain, this is the driest month.

  • July brings the wettest conditions. You can expect around 11 days of rainfall.
